Ok, so I've devised up some more questions for you all! I use to play WoW until I hit 80, but then I didn't really see any reason to continue to gain armor because it was just another grind. I currently play Eve Online with no real satisfaction when playing it. So here are the questions!

Official TMRNetShark Questions For Aion:

  • Smaller than WoW, correct? But still filled with tons of quests and none really too similar (Get me away from Dailies!)?
  • Cities? How many MAIN cities? Are there smaller towns and bases for supplies and such?
  • Armor System, do you have to repair your armor and such? Does it get more and more expensive as you level? (I hated 50g repairs)
  • Definite room for expansions (like BC and WotLK for Wow)?
  • There is actually people playing it? How many people can fit on a server? (Estimate)
  • Is there a possible prevention of the number of "powerful" classes? (CoughPaladinCough)
  • Would someone who played Wow and enjoyed leveling in it (me) enjoy leveling in Aion?
  • And lastly, END game material... Will it keep me going (Like PvPvE and such for Armor or reknown or Cool looking Wings!)?
1. Lots of quests in 1.0(even though quest-exp scale poorly in 1.0, is fixed for our release). Haven't seen any dailies, only repeatable you can do 100times in total, what happens when you do all of them I dunno, never bothered :>
2. There's one main city for both sides(panda&sanctum). Though there are atleast one outpost for supplies(they have everything maybe except crafters & pvp-vendor & broker(see it like AH from wow, but only buyout).
3. No rmor repaid, you can buy shards though which increase your physical damage, quite expensive but quite useful.
4. After version 1.5 they've said there will be bigger update which most likely can be compared to expansions, though I tihnk it's more like Lineage2 system with chronicles(that will say big update lvl-increase and alot of stuff happens, but free compared to expansion).
5. Don't really understand, but there's no über-class that kicks everyones butt, but some classes are better than some depending on circumstances. Also some pvp-skills etc will be balanced in 1.5.
6. Dunno how many thhere are per server, haven't read anything about that, but EU servers had 20k spamming login-server CBT3-4 when it had 4servers, and were'nt any special queue to get in(though it did happen that it was above 600person before you in queue on the biggest servers).
7. There's instances and group-quests/campaign, it won't be fast to level to 50, but it won't be slow either. Olny leveled to 30 myself so can only talk from my experience there.
8. There's castle-sieges which gives you access to special instances only to the legion owning it, are also quite some world bosses and pve-instances. Also there's pvp-ranking and top 3 gain special abilities that's worth farming for if you feel like it. I dunno amount of instances etc, but I heard that around 20instanced in total are added in 1.5(most of them are end-game what I've read).

I tried to find Aion reviews but no one them were truly satisfying in terms of depth.

I have a few questions for those who tried it:
1. Can you list the biggest pros and cons of Aion? Justification a plus but not required.
2. How well and how fun is the flying?
3. Any other particularly cool, unique features that has less hype in the media?
4. How fun is the combat and how does it differentiate itself from other MMOs?
5. Worth playing when it goes live?

Thanks to anyone who answers. :)

(Please note, I've only played the beta up to level 21)

1. Some of the leveling can get tedious (oh shit... just like every mmo i've played!) and some of the quests can be done at way low levels if you're playing your class right (I think I did a level 17 quest at level 13 as a templar).  However, the game UI is very user friendly and [most] quests are pretty straightforward (as in don't require dredging around the entire zone just to find some guys shoe, who lost it at an undisclosed location... nothing like that)

2. Flying is restricted to certain areas in the zones (kinda disappointed about this) HOWEVER its still extremely fun in the areas you can use it.  And I believe that in the Abyss (end game) you can fly nearly everywhere (I think the higher levels you are, the more flight areas open up)

3. The only one I can think of is that every server is suppose to end up branching off and making their own lore.  As in, different outcomes from server firsts and what not depending on who does what or how they do it will end up changing the server compared to another server (Please note, This is what I hear, and I'm not sure how in depth it will be.  Could be pretty sweet though)

4. Combat for the most part is pretty straightforward.  You got your Tanks/DPS/Heals.  Each class has a combo system (think assassins from Guild Wars if you've played it) where you start with a base attack, which chains to another attack or effect (for example, Templars have a chain that goes Damage > Damage > Damage |  or Damage > Shout (which ups your damage and prevents some damage)

5. Worth getting?  Dunno.  I'm most likely going to check it out when it goes live.  I'm hoping that the end game material will be a challenge for most of the game unlike what Blizzard did with WoW and turned it into a cakewalk, where end game status didn't mean anything anymore.
